Unmet health care needs due to discrimination in the U.S. in 2022, by sexuality
In 2022, over 40 percent of transgender and intersex adults surveyed reported having delayed or avoided getting preventive screenings due to disrespect or discrimination from health care providers, in comparison to only seven percent of non-LGBTQ+ adults. The statistic illustrates the share of U.S. adults who postponed or avoided getting necessary medical care or preventive screenings in the past year due to disrespect or discrimination from healthcare in the U.S. as of 2022, by sexuality and demography.
